It is critical to pay attention to the extent of teacher knowledge and to
support teachers throughout the project process in order for students
to fully engage in the project topic (Satchwell & Loepp, 2002). This
paper outlines the research underlying successful project-based STEM
education and refers educators to a unique curriculum that supports
teachers to implement a project that encourages students to solve
problems in science, technology, engineering, and math (STEM) fields.
